The Facts:
Romo said he will not play in Sunday's game against Tampa Bay. Romo speaking on Terrell Owens' radio show on Tuesday, said was disappointed yet feels its the right decision not to play until he's ready. "I'll say it will be Brad [Johnson]," Romo said.
Reported by the Dallas Morning News
Fantasy Football Diehards Line:
Romo, who suffered a broken pinkie finger on his throwing finger two weeks ago, served as Johnson's backup last week but team officials have since admitted they would have gone with Brooks Bollinger if they needed to make a change in St. Louis. Romo went on to suggest he might not return soon. "Right now, we're going to rally around Brad and hopefully we can get two wins out of this and go into the bye and get everyone healthy and go on from there." That would jibe with initial reports suggesting Romo wouldn't return until after the bye.
